Marguerita House is located in the centre of Bessan and 12 mins to the beach .
This is a delightful character village house that is ideal for families or small groups of friends.It is situated close to shops ,bars and restaurants.On the ground floor is a large spacious living room and kitchen.The kitchen comes fully equipped with a dishwasher,washing machine,cooker,microwave,toaster,kettle,large filter coffee machine,fridge freezer and caters for all your cooking needs,leading off of the kitchen there are double doors and wooden shutters that can be opened to let in plenty of air during the hot summer months. The large wooden dining table can be extended to seat up to 10 people. In the living room there is a wood burning stove,a Flatscreen TV and DVD Player,also comfortable sofas and a large double futon.There are shelved boxes of toys and games for children young to older.Back in the kitchen and a traditional tiled spiral staircase leads upstairs to 3 good sized and comfortable bedrooms,a small Juliette balcony off the first double room,a second double room and then a large single room plus a double futon in the downstairs living area for extra guests. All beds have mattress protectors and pillows with protectors and bedcovers/duvets stored there for the winter.There are 2 bathrooms; a family bathroom upstairs containing a shower,basin unit and toilet.Downstairs a shower and basin and in the large kitchen a separate toilet.Beach toys and accessories are available. Market days in Bessan are on Tuesday,s and Sunday,s selling a wide range of local and organic produce. Stalls also sell a variety of clothes,accessories and gifts;a very popular market particularly during the summer months.Although there is no garden(as with many village houses)it is quite normal to sit outside the front of the property and you will see many locals do this also with small BBQ ,s too. It was ten years ago when I first visited Bessan and after driving through sun drenched vineyards I was excited to arrive in a village that still maintained both it's ancient traditions and architecture .The house itself is in a prime location set in the historical centre and by the medieval church ;it is a special place to witness local festivities and really feel in touch with the community.Stand on the Juliette balcony and feel the gentle breeze from the Herault river that is a 5 min walk away past the vineyards.Everytime I visit Bessan it doesn't take long to wind down and relax ,a truly inviting house and village.
